Review: Schwalbe tyre levers.

Because I use Continental tyres, which tend to be fairly tight fitting, I've been using bog standard metal tyre levers for the past couple of years. They work well but they can scratch the anodising on your rims so I decided to try Schwalbe's plastic tyre levers instead. They are widely available and usually priced at around £3 for three.



I've used Park plastic tyre levers in the past and wasn't impressed, they tended to bend when trying to wrestle a particularly stubborn tyre on, so I was really hoping these would be better. By complete coincidence, when I examined the front tyre after hitting the pothole at the end of November it was flat so I decided to try the new levers. As it turned out, there was a thorn in the tyre which was quickly sorted with a new tube. The tyre levers are fantastic, they're very thin which makes them a cinch to get under the bead and they're extremely strong, they barely bend at all.

Overall, very impressed!
